Phenylephrine nasal sprays (Neo-Synephrine) were not included in this announcement and are still considered an effective option. Top alternatives to phenylephrine include pseudoephedrine (Sudafed), oxymetazoline (Afrin), and fluticasone propionate (Flonase). DayQuil is a popular over-the-counter medication designed to alleviate common cold symptoms, such as congestion, cough, and minor aches. It typically contains ingredients like acetaminophen, dextromethorphan, and phenylephrine, which work synergistically to provide relief from these symptoms. Blood thinners are used to prevent and treat blood clots. Examples include warfarin (Coumadin, Jantoven), apixaban (Eliquis), and rivaroxaban (Xarelto). Methylprednisolone can change how blood thinners work in the body. ….
